Saint Christopher. Jet. Spanish School, 16th century.
A carving showing a male figure standing on a base and carrying a child on his shoulders. Saint Christopher of Lycia, best known thanks to the spread of the Golden Legend by James of the Voragine from the 13th century onwards, was best known for having crossed a river with Christ disguised as a child on his shoulders. Compare this work with the 16th-century jet-carved Saint James with Pilgrims in the Cathedral Museum of Ávila (Spain), the examples in the Valencia Museum of Don Juan (Madrid), etc.
· Size: 5x3x16 cms

Dream of a saint. Carved and polychrome wood. Flemish school, 16th century.
Relief made of carved and polychrome wood that shows an old man with a particular headdress (reminiscent of some chaperones) lying on a bed and accompanied by two friars dressed in habits, who talk to each other. Iconographically, the figure of the old man lying on the bed (note the cushion that raises the upper part of the body, following the common use of the time) who has not died (probably) because he was not completely lying down, is reminiscent of how he was usually represented, for example, to San Antón, San Jerónimo, etc. It is not very likely that it is the subject of the Transit or Death of Saint Francis of Assisi due to the absence of the Stigmata and due to age. It would be part of a cycle of scenes in the altarpiece of a church, an accompaniment that would give the viewer more clues about the identity of those represented.
